From student job to national role at Loblaw
August 5, 2025

Cameron Hyjek’s career at Loblaw began when he was just 17, working part-time at ZehrsTM Conestoga Mall in Waterloo, Ont. Initially a student job, it quickly became a meaningful foundation for his professional journey. Working in-store taught Cameron the essentials of customer service, operations, and teamwork—skills he continues to leverage today.
Reflecting on his beginnings, Cameron notes, “I wouldn't be where I am today without the opportunities given to me at Zehrs Conestoga.”
Encouraged by his department manager, Daryl Bridge, Cameron decided to look beyond the store level and applied to Loblaw’s internship program. He saw the internship as more than just another job; it was his opportunity to build a long-term career.
Within a year, Cameron progressed from Intern to Associate Merchant and now holds his current role as Merchant overseeing the national bulk foods portfolio. His rapid advancement underscores his determination and relationship-building skills, fostered by the guidance and mentorship he received along the way. Cameron credits Loblaw’s supportive culture for helping him grow professionally and personally, noting, “Leaders here genuinely invest in people and their success.”
Today, Cameron remains focused on driving growth, maximizing impact, and fostering a customer-centric mindset. He takes particular pride in projects that energize and engage the bulk foods category, overseeing processes like flyer promotions to supply chain collaboration and vendor negotiations.
Looking ahead, Cameron is clear about his ambitions. Driven by a passion for leadership and helping others succeed, he aspires to inspire and mentor future leaders. “I’ve always wanted to be a leader and a role model,” Cameron says, motivated by opportunities to build strong teams and share the mentorship that propelled his own growth.
His advice to others seeking career growth at Loblaw is straightforward: "Be consistent, communicate clearly, stay flexible, trust yourself, and remain open to feedback."
Cameron’s journey—from a local Zehrs in Waterloo to influencing national assortments at Loblaw—highlights the career possibilities available for those who actively seek growth, embrace mentorship, and clearly articulate their ambitions. “It’s important to lead, inspire, and help others succeed. When one of us grows, we all grow.”
